Ilian Simeonov was born on January 6, 1963 in Yambol, Bulgaria. In 1992, he graduated from the National Academy for Theatre and Film Art, Sofia, Bulgaria with a degree in "film directing". Among the films which Ilian Simeonov directed are "Prayer for Lake Baikal", "Border"( together with Christian Nochev), "I have an idea," "Sombrero Blues," "Rage" and "Warden of the Dead." He won the Union of Bulgarian Filmmakers' Award for the best film for the movie "Warden of the Dead," and also the Prize for debut "Golden Rose" in 1994 for his film "Border". He died on March 13, 2008 in Sofia, Bulgaria.
